According to our (Global Info Research) latest study, the global Visual Inspection Microscope market size was valued at US$ 1738 million in 2025 and is forecast to a readjusted size of US$ 3232 million by 2032 with a CAGR of 9.4% during review period.
In 2024, approximately 433,000 new Visual Inspection Microscopes were delivered globally, with an average unit price of approximately US$1,600–5,200 (depending on resolution, automation level, and digital imaging system configuration). The industry average gross margin remained at 32%–46%. These are industrial inspection devices that enable micron- and submicron-level structural observation, surface defect identification, precision measurement, and yield monitoring through high-NA objectives, stable compound illumination, and digital imaging modules. Typical magnifications range from 20× to 1,000×, with NA values between 0.25 and 0.95. They can be configured with autofocus (AFA), digital measurement (DMI), and report tracking modules and are widely deployed in wafer manufacturing, SMT packaging, optical coating, precision machining, and quality inspection laboratories, serving as a fundamental tool in modern industrial yield control systems.
Advanced packaging, wafer metallization, and optical coating all require shorter process dwell times. Microscopic inspection must possess high stability and rapid re-judgment capabilities. Industrial yield pressures are significantly increasing. Benefiting from the rigid demand for "micro-defect recognition + real-time monitoring" in industrial yield control, microscopic inspection is rising from an auxiliary means to a decisive yield control tool. A 1% decrease in industrial product yield can increase manufacturing costs by 4%–6%, making microscopic inspection the most certain investment direction in factory automation. As chip linewidths decrease, optical structures become more multi-layered, and electronic packaging becomes more refined, defect types are becoming increasingly complex, expanding from traditional particles and scratches to interface residues, metal voids, film pinholes, solder joint fatigue, and more. This necessitates higher NA (nanometry) and more diverse illumination methods. The demand for visual inspection microscopes will continue to grow steadily, elevating their industry status from "inspection equipment" to "yield assurance infrastructure."
